Anna was a historical fractional currency denomination used in various countries influenced by British colonial administration, representing one-sixteenth of a rupee. Because the anna is obsolete and no longer minted as active legal tender currency, its modern financial worth is strictly numismatic. Individual copper or nickel anna coins trade among coin collectors and vintage currency hobbyists for anywhere from a few dollars to tens of dollars depending on the specific year, mint mark, and preservation condition.
